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2279 390569 74727
899107379 81632685
899107379 81632685
613935 307055204 642 045939393 2145695
All about undefined
Interested in learning more?
899107379 81632685
613935 307055204 642 045939393 2145695
See more
047 6761
5743654137 1333614986 95
See more
782216083 997 10351574177
8442561 33 32629
See more